2. Difficulties Of Reusing Solar Panels
It is widely accepted that reusing solar panels has numerous ecological benefits, nevertheless, it is also real that the process isn't without its challenges. Yet just what are these difficulties? Let's explore additionally.
One of the largest issues with reusing photovoltaic panels is the intricacy of the job itself. It can be challenging to break down the various parts, such as glass and steel, to be reused individually. In addition, photovoltaic panel makers commonly have a mix of materials used in their products which makes arranging them much more difficult. Additionally, there are security and health and wellness dangers included with handling damaged glass or inhaling fumes from thawing parts.
One more essential obstacle associated with reusing photovoltaic panels is price. Several countries do not have enough framework or resources to appropriately recycle these items which results in higher expenditures for services trying to do so. In addition, as a result of the customized nature of recycling solar panels, this can produce an economic burden on firms trying to remain compliant with policies. Ultimately, these expenses could be given to customers making it challenging for them to pay for renewable energy sources.
